4 minutes ago, choco said:

DT was a position of strength? 

Yes, I believe many said that the DT position was a strong one this year in the draft. There are  at least 6 DTs or DT/DEs listed among the Top 25 draft prospects:

Williams of Alabama

Gary of Michigan

Oliver of Houston

Wilkins of Clemson

Lawrence of Clemson

Dremont Jones of Ohio State.

In addition  at least 4 other players are considered Top 25 edge rushers:

Bosa OSU

Sweat  Mississippi St.

Allen Kentucky

Burns  FSU

So....theoretically   10 of the Top 25 draft picks could turn out to be players on the DL.

Plus you have ILBs  Devin White and Devin Bush

So almost half of all the top picks could be Defensive front 7 players.

Plus just behind the top 25 you have guys like   Simmons of Miss. St.  Tillery of ND, and Ferguson of La. Tech...... So, half of the entire first round could be front 7 players.

Texans add S Gipson after Mathieu exit

The Houston Texans will be signing safety Tashaun Gipson, sources told ESPN's Dianna Russini. Gipson, who was released by the Jacksonville Jaguars on March 8 as part of the team's effort to create salary-cap space, started all 48 games since joining the team and had six interceptions and 16 pass breakups.

Patriots tender WR Gordon

The New England Patriots have placed an original-round tender on suspended/restricted free-agent WR Josh Gordon ($2.025 million). This counts against the team's salary cap. So if Gordon is ever reinstated by the NFL, he would be looking at a one-year, $2.025 million contract. Technically, another team could sign him to an offer sheet, and if the Patriots didn't match it, the club would receive a second-round draft pick in return because that's the round in which Gordon entered the NFL. But draft-pick compensation, and financial terms of a contract, are naturally secondary to Gordon's health and well-being at this point.
